Re: Login with an alias ID

2013-02-28 Thread Dan White
On 02/28/13 11:33 +0530, Ram wrote:
Does cyrus implement login with an alias id
If the mailbox of a user is created with a long email id , it may be
helpful to allow login with a short nickname

So the user has a choice of logging in with either his full email-id or
nickname to the same mailbox

You can implement this using a sasl canonicalization plugin. Sasl version
2.1.25 (and greater) supports canonicalization with the ldapdb shared
library.  There is a patch in bugzilla to implement support in the sql
shared library.

See: http://www.cyrussasl.org/docs/cyrus-sasl/2.1.25/options.php (search
for 'canon').

The best source of documentation is the cyrus-sasl mailing list archives.
